Wallet Permissions Deep Dive: Understanding Control and Security
March 2, 2026In the world of digital assets, a wallet is more than just a storage container—it’s your gateway to managing funds, interacting with apps, and participating in decentralized networks. But how much control do you actually have over who can do what in your wallet? That’s where wallet permissions come in.
This article provides a comprehensive wallet permissions deep dive, explaining how permissions work, why they matter, and how you can manage them safely, even if you’re new to crypto or digital wallets.
What is Wallet Permissions Deep Dive?
Think of your wallet as a house. Wallet permissions are like the keys you hand out:
- Full access keys allow someone to move funds freely.
- Limited keys might let someone see balances or interact with certain apps but not withdraw funds.
In essence, a wallet permissions deep dive examines all the ways you can grant, monitor, and restrict access to your wallet, ensuring security while maintaining usability.
Analogy: Giving a friend a spare key to your house—but only to access the living room, not your safe.
How Wallet Permissions Deep Dive Works
Wallet permissions involve setting rules and controls at multiple layers. Here’s a breakdown:
Step 1: Assigning Access Levels
Different wallets allow different permission levels:
- Read-only access: View balances and transaction history
- Transaction approval: Approve spending or contract interactions
- Full control: Send, receive, and manage all wallet operations
Example: A DeFi app might request permission to spend a certain token on your behalf—but you can limit it to a specific amount.
Step 2: Connecting with dApps
When you connect a wallet to decentralized apps (dApps):
- You’re granting permissions for the app to interact with your funds.
- Permissions are usually token- or contract-specific.
- Smart contracts enforce the limits you set.
Step 3: Monitoring and Revoking Permissions
A critical part of wallet security is ongoing oversight:
- Review all active permissions regularly
- Revoke unnecessary or suspicious access
- Use wallet management tools to track which dApps can interact with your funds
Key Features / Benefits / Importance
- Enhanced Security: Prevent unauthorized withdrawals
- Granular Control: Limit dApp access to only what’s needed
- Transparency: See which apps and contracts have permissions
- Flexibility: Grant temporary or token-specific permissions
- Risk Management: Reduce exposure to hacks and phishing attacks
Real-World Use Cases
1. DeFi Applications
Users grant permission to liquidity pools or lending platforms, often limiting the amount a smart contract can spend to reduce risk.
2. NFT Marketplaces
Wallet permissions control which contracts can list, bid, or transfer NFTs on your behalf.
3. Multi-Signature Wallets
Permissions are used to require multiple approvals for high-value transactions, adding a layer of security.
4. Crypto Custody Services
Organizations manage wallet permissions for employees, ensuring internal controls while maintaining operational efficiency.
Pros & Cons
Pros
- Strong control over digital assets
- Limits exposure to malicious apps
- Enhances trust in decentralized networks
- Enables flexible interaction with smart contracts
Cons
- Complexity can confuse new users
- Mismanagement may lock users out
- Temporary permissions may be forgotten, creating vulnerabilities
Common Mistakes to Avoid
- Granting full access to untrusted dApps
- Ignoring permission revocation after use
- Using wallets without granular permission controls
- Failing to monitor active permissions regularly
- Assuming default permissions are always safe
Frequently Asked Questions (FAQs)
1. Why are wallet permissions important?
They control who or what can access your funds, reducing the risk of unauthorized transactions.
2. Can I grant temporary permissions to a dApp?
Yes, many wallets and smart contracts allow temporary or token-specific permissions.
3. How do I revoke permissions?
Most wallets provide dashboards or management tools to review and revoke permissions granted to apps and contracts.
4. What happens if I give full access to a malicious dApp?
The dApp could move or steal your assets. Always check permissions before granting access.
5. Are wallet permissions standard across all wallets?
No, different wallets offer different granularity and features for permission management.
Conclusion
A wallet permissions deep dive is essential for anyone serious about digital asset security. By understanding access levels, granting selective permissions, and regularly monitoring activity, users can interact safely with dApps, DeFi platforms, and blockchain networks.
The takeaway? Your wallet isn’t just a storage tool—it’s a command center. Treat permissions like keys to your digital kingdom: grant wisely, monitor closely, and revoke when necessary to keep your assets safe.